When scrolling from left to right and then backwards using the cursor keys or the scrollbar arrow keys, the cell grid gets distorted. Changing the zoom level or minimizing/maximizing the window refreshes the screen. Scrolling up/down or scrolling using the scrollbar (dragging the scrollbar with the mouse) doesn't distort the grid.
